Now that Peach & Lily has created the Glass Skin Refining Serum and the Glass Skin Veil Mist and people have had the chance to fall in love with the skin-perfecting properties of the products, the brand is introducing the Glass Skin Water-Gel Moisturizer. The K-beauty brand's new moisturizer is balancing, hydrating and strengthening, thanks to a formula that combines hyaluronic acid with vegan prebiotics and probiotics.
In Korean beauty, "glass skin" describes skin that's dewy and virtually translucent. Often achieved with multi-step skincare routines, glass skin is being simplified for consumers who want the benefit of crystal-clear skin with more ease. As Peach & Lily founder Alicia Yoon told Allure, "We wanted to bring these outliers into the fold and say glass skin is your healthiest skin, which is for everyone."
